Core Analysis Engine [Expand]

The central orchestrator for stacktrace lookup and analysis. It coordinates interactions with the Git Interaction and Traceback Parsing modules and populates the Result Management module. It provides the main entry points for the application's core logic.

Git Interaction

Responsible for all interactions with the Git version control system. This includes retrieving file information, commit history, performing line-specific lookups (e.g., git blame or git pickaxe), and converting Git-specific time formats.

Trace Parsing

Specializes in parsing raw stack trace text from various programming languages into a structured, programmatic format. It defines a class hierarchy to handle different trace formats (e.g., Python, Java, JavaScript).

Result Management

Manages, stores, and provides access to the structured results of the stack trace analysis. It aggregates information, linking parsed stack trace lines with relevant Git commits, files, and authors.

Command-Line Interface (CLI)

Provides the primary command-line interface for users to interact with the git-stacktrace tool. It handles argument parsing, input validation, and orchestrates calls to the Core Analysis Engine based on user commands.

Web Interface

Implements a web server (using Flask/FastAPI) to offer a graphical user interface or RESTful API endpoints for the git-stacktrace functionality. It handles web requests and renders HTML templates for user interaction.
